“Exercise Lafaek 2012″ between F-FDTL and the U.S. Navy

“Exercise Lafaek”, organized by FALINTIL – Defence Forces of Timor-Leste and the Naval Component of the Armed Forces of the United States took place between the 9th and the 16th of October 2012 in Dili, Timor-Leste.

The purpose of this military action was the exchange of experiences.

The Chief of the General Staff of the F-FDTL, Lere Anan Timur, highlighted the strengthening of the bilateral relations between these two countries, as a result of this military exercise. “The U.S. Navy served this opportunity to transfer their experience to the F-FDTL, not only at an individual level, but also at a collective one. We exercised the practice of urban combat and deepened the issue of the chain of command. In return, our forces shared issues about the Military Corps Center. This exercise should be repeated next year, “he said.

The U.S. Ambassador Judith Fergin, also stressed the importance of the strengthening of relations between these two countries, adding that the practice of this exercise also contributes to the maintenance of regional security by approaching the military from friendly countries.

“With this exercise, the capacity of the Timorese military have been strengthened relatively to humanitarian assistance, emergency relief during natural disasters and to collective capabilities. This will benefit both Timor-Leste and the countries of the region, since it will allow Timor-Leste to participate in peacekeeping operations “reinforced the Ambassador.

The closing ceremony of the “Exercise Lafaek 2012″ took place in Taci Tolu, Dili, and was attended by the Secretary of State for Defense, Júlio Tomás Pinto, the U.S. Ambassador to Timor-Leste Judith Fergin, the Chief of the General Staff Armed Forces of Timor-Leste, Lere Anan Timur, the Chief of Staff of F-FDTL, Colonel Falur Rate Laek, and the U.S. Navy Colonel, Scott Campell.
